3

3. The system of claim 1, wherein the multiple convolutional neural network layers further comprise batch normalization to normalize a scale of the encoded image and reduce internal covariance shift between the multiple convolutional neural network layers.

4

4. The system of claim 1, wherein the multiple convolutional neural network layers further comprise using one or more linear-activation functions.

5

5. The system of claim 1, wherein embedding the steganographic layer containing randomized portions of the secret image further comprises applying multiple hidden convolutional layers during encoding and wherein the hidden layers are applied between at least two separate convolutional neural network layers.
